Cricket Wireless, a wholly owned AT&T subsidiary, rolls out a summer lineup of unlimited‑talk, text, and data plans starting at $30 per month. The carrier pairs these plans with no‑fee perks like HBO Max and free 2‑day shipping, positioning itself as a budget alternative for Android users.

Promotions include a free Moto G Stylus (2025) or Galaxy A37 5G when customers add a line to an eligible Unlimited plan. No trade‑in or activation fee is required, and existing owners can bring their own device to receive up to $300 off when they commit to service in advance.

Cricket also offers a 14‑day free trial, letting prospects test the network without disrupting their current data plan. The carrier promises no hidden taxes or fees and allows zero‑penalty cancellation, making the switch straightforward for families or small businesses looking to cut monthly costs.
